Subject: Key rotation following the Marroway cache postmortem

Team — per the stale-cache postmortem (invalidation events dropped for six hours while the old credential kept authenticating), we've rotated the Lanternfeed service key. The old key is dead as of 09:00. Update the on-call runbook and your local env before your next shift. The new key for the invalidation service is below.

app token of kahof-bawef = zpat15_fBgQ21m0VYHrmWY

Ticket #— Floor 9 Opening Prep, Brindlemoor House

Hi facilities folks, Floor 9 opens to staff next Monday and we need a few things squared away before then. Lift access is live, but the two side doors by the kitchenette are still on the old lock config — please reprogram them before Friday. Also, signage for the quiet rooms hasn't arrived, so pop up the temporary printed ones for now. Until the badge readers sync, the interim door code for Floor 9 is below.

door code, bajop-bajog: bdg-DSWAC-43621

Ticket: Lift maintenance this weekend

Heads up, new folks — both lifts at Carden Place are out Saturday and Sunday for the annual service by Veltway Engineering. Use the stairs by the kitchen. If you're lugging anything heavy, the goods lift in the annexe still runs, but you'll need to badge through the back corridor. The access code for that corridor is below.

staff pass of haweg-bafop = bdg-G-69

Internal Memo — Next Year's Training Budget

Branch managers: the central training allocation rises 5% next year, weighted toward the new Pellgrove product certifications. Each branch receives a base grant plus headcount top-up; travel for courses is capped per attendee. Submit your draft plans by the end of next month for consolidation. The confidential note on the wider capability plan appears below.

internal memo for kawip-hadug: Headcount on the Wenwyn team goes from 7 to 140 by the end of January. Gross margin on Wenwyn came in at 20 percent against a plan of 15 percent.